Garlic Mushrooms

These garlic mushrooms are easy to make by sautéing sliced mushrooms in butter with red wine. Delicious with grilled steaks or on top of toasted bread for a tasty appetizer.

Prep Time:
5 mins
Cook Time:
15 mins
Total Time:
20 mins
Servings:
4

Ingredients

  • 1 tablespoon butter

  • 2 pounds sliced fresh mushrooms

  • 4 cloves garlic, minced

  • 1 teaspoon dried basil

  • 1 cup red wine

Directions

  1. Heat butter in a skillet over medium heat. Add mushrooms and garlic; cook and stir until mushrooms are a light golden brown and liquid has evaporated, about 10 minutes. Stir in basil.

  2. Reduce heat to low, and pour wine into the skillet. Simmer until wine has mostly evaporated. Serve immediately.
